Queen Requirements (Health & Eligibility)
To protect all cats and programs involved, we require the following for visiting queens:
- Age & Cycle: Mature, robust health, arriving ideally on day 2–3 of standing heat.
- Vaccinations: FVRCP & Rabies up to date (provide proof).
- Infectious Disease: Recent negative FeLV/FIV (within 30–60 days).
- Parasites: Current flea/tick prevention; free of internal/external parasites.
- Wellness Exam: Vet exam within 30–60 days.
- Grooming: Nails trimmed; sanitary groom recommended.
- Behavior: Human-social and tolerant of short, private confinement.
Documentation verified at check-in. We may decline service if requirements aren’t met.
How Stud Service Works (Step-by-Step)
- Inquiry & Approval: Start via Contact. Share queen’s pedigree, health records, timing, and breeding goals.
- Contract & Reservation: Written contract provided; reservation fee holds dates.
- Arrival & Check-In: We verify records and settle the queen into a private, sanitized stud suite.
- Breeding Window: Typical stay 2–4 days during standing heat; supervised introductions and monitoring.
- Pick-Up & Report: You’ll receive a written breeding report with observed matings.
- Pregnancy Confirmation: Update us at 28–35 days (ultrasound or vet confirmation).
- Live Kitten Guarantee (LKG): Contract provides a rebreed window if no pregnancy or no live kittens (vet proof required).
